Andrew Driver looks to have been all but priced out of a move to Coventry City, while Leeds United's Jermaine Beckford seems more likely to end up playing for Yorkshire rivals Sheffield United than Coventry City.
And, with the club refusing to be held to ransom over potential targets, academy players Ashley Cain, Jermaine Grandison, Adam Walker and Curtis Wynter have all been offered one-year professional contracts - though it has been suggested that said players are likely to be offered out on loan.
